About the 01392 dialling code
01392 is the UK geographic dialling code for Exeter, allocated by Ofcom under the National Telephone Numbering Plan. It is used by landlines — and increasingly VoIP lines — registered to the Exeter area.
A full Exeter number is normally written as 01392 XXXXXX. You can dial the local part on its own from within the same area, or the full number from anywhere in the UK.
Because of UK number portability and internet calling, a 01392 number no longer guarantees the caller is physically in Exeter. Fraudsters also "spoof" local codes like 01392 so an unknown call looks like a nearby business or neighbour — so treat an unexpected call on what is actually said, not on the area code alone.

Calling 01392 from abroad
From outside the UK, dial your international access prefix, then the UK country code 44, then 1392 (the area code without its leading zero) and the local number.
| Calling from | Dial |
|---|---|
| United States & Canada | 011 44 1392 … |
| Europe / most of the world | 00 44 1392 … |
| Australia | 0011 44 1392 … |
| Any mobile phone | +44 1392 … |
History of the 01392 code
The code was 0392 until PhONEday, 16 April 1995, when a "1" was inserted after the leading zero to create 01392.
In the letter-dialling era the code had the mnemonic EX2 — on an old rotary dial, the letters EX (from Exeter) sat on the same holes as the digits 392, so subscribers literally dialled the start of the town's name.

Is a call from 01392 safe?
Most 01392 calls are ordinary local calls from Exeter homes and businesses. The main risk to be aware of is "neighbour spoofing", where a scammer fakes a local 01392 prefix so you are more likely to answer. Never share bank details, passwords or one-time security codes with an unexpected caller, even when the number looks local — hang up and call the organisation back on a number you have verified yourself.
